Chronic disease and recent addiction treatment utilization among alcohol and drug dependent adults
<p>Abstract</p> <p>Background</p> <p>Chronic medical diseases require regular and longitudinal care and self-management for effective treatment. When chronic diseases include substance use disorders, care and treatment of both the medical and addiction disorders may aff...
